Here comes 2 great PDF books : Top Symbols and Trademarks of the World – volume 1 ( 130 pages – 520 logos – 8 MB ) Top Symbols and Trademarks of the World – volume 2 ( 155 pages – 600 logos – 17.5 MB ) — “Top Symbols And Trademarks Of The World” was published in 1973, written by Franco Maria Ricci & Corinna Ferrari. There are two volumes of this Italian book, which are very hard to find now. Maybe…

The following text is from the PDF above: _ The PITCH-IN symbol This symbol of a stylized person cleaning up the environment was adopted in 1976. This is stated on the website of PITCH-IN Canada (www.pitch-in.ca) – associated Clean World International. PITCH-IN Canada is a non-profit organization with worldwide membership.
